LIK, the modern-day purveyors of classic Swedish death metal, gloriously return to action with their fourth album, Necro, on April 18th via Metal Blade Records.

Standing loud and proud over so many imitators, Necro is the musical equivalent of a classic shock-horror movie that’s drenched in blood and gore and packed with over-the-top extremities. Delve beyond the zombified cover art created by Stockholm-based tattooist and artist Jens Olsson (Ink Fanatics), Necro serves as a reminder of just how special and exciting the genre is: packed with blood-curdling fantasy stories about war, death, zombies, world apocalypse, and murder all stacked with disgustingly-good rotten riffs.

After recording and releasing their critically acclaimed third full-length, 2020’s Misanthropic Breed, during the pandemic, this time around getting back into the studio properly was paramount. And while Misanthropic Breed was recorded at the quartet’s rehearsal space where the band produced all their demos, LIK recorded Necro at NBS Studio (AKA Necromorbus Studio) in Söderfors, two hours from their home city.

Once again using uber-producer Lawrence Mackrory (Meshuggah, Katatonia, High Parasite, Decapitated), all music was recorded live over a three-day period, before vocalist/guitarist Tomas Åkvik headed to Uppsala to record his vocals at Mackrory’s Rorysound Studios. Mackrory has worked with LIK – whose name translates to “corpse” in Swedish – since their 2015 debut Mass Funeral Evocation and throughout their Metal Blade Records’ career that started with 2018’s Carnage.

Within Necro‘s ten tracks, LIK has created a seamless album, diverse in tempo but without losing any of their blood-soaked intensity and relentless in-your-face-attitude listeners have come to expect. There are twists and turns that keep LIK on a progressive path without straying from their old-school trademark sounds inspired by the godfathers Dismember, At The Gates and, of course, Entombed.

“We didn’t really want to repeat ourselves, but of course we wanted the LIK sound,” explains Åkvik on the writing trajectory of Necro.

In advance of the record’s release, Lik unleashes first single, “War Praise.” Åkvik elaborates, “We had to write this track before we could even start working on the new album. A LIK track that felt just like LIK but with enough new stuff to make it interesting for us. Sadly enough the world is still plagued by wars so we had to write about the horrors of it.”

Necro, which features guest appearances by Nick Holmes (Paradise Lost, Bloodbath), Linnea Landstedt (Tyranex/Ice Age), and Lawrence Mackrory (F.K.Ü.), will be released on CD and digital formats as well as vinyl in the following color variants.

Eg Er Framand traces back to Sylvaine’s earliest roots.

Kathrine Shepard grew up in Norway, amidst the contrasts between nature and urbanity, on the outskirts of downtown Oslo. While studying music, dance and drama in high school, she performed several times at the Kampen Church. This 19th century relic is where Kathrine recorded most of Eg Er Framand, which includes interpretations of traditional Norwegian folk songs, along with three of her own original songs to the cannon.

When Sylvaine first heard the title track, it hit her like no other song had before. Since then, she’s shared “Eg Er Framand” with rapturous audiences everywhere, but this EP is the first time she’s captured its magic on record. Each note is held with soft restraint, as if cupped into the palm of her hand, like an offering. Close your eyes and envision her reaching through the trees, into the shadows, as her feet slowly lift off the ground. 

To this day, “Dagsens Augo Sloknar” still has mysterious origins, but the lyrics were written in 1891 by Elias Blix, a professor-turned-politician who also wrote hymns. Staying true to the original’s delicate, reverent melody, Sylvaine sings in a breathy, elongated whisper that’s haunting and soothing, like a shadow. But while it opens with just a steady hum of organ, her rendition ends by pulling you into a trance.

Atrox Trauma was founded in 2008 in Hungary. Their goal, according to the music genre, was clear from the beginning: thrash metal with death metal influences. The band recorded 2 EPs during its earlier years besides performing on live gigs. The band’s strength increased in 2019, and they have been spinning at an unstoppable speed since then. It gave a series of concerts in its motherland and countries in the neighborhood. The band creates a huge listener experience with its tight, intense, fast, and face-tearing music.
In 2022 they released their first LP called ‘On The Line Of Nothing And Something’ by the Italian label WormHoleDeath.The listener can experience everything from intense immersion to melodic thrash metal. Four music videos provide visual support for the fan-approachable experience.
By the end of 2024, they took the stage in many countries, performing in tours and festivals, and recorded their second LP ”Where Death Hunts”.
